Skip to content

Commit de24c46

Browse files
committed
api: Remove deprecated getmyoffer
The getmyoffer api was deprecated in 2021.
1 parent 5f5938b commit de24c46

File tree

8 files changed

+4
-90
lines changed

8 files changed

+4
-90
lines changed

cli/src/main/java/bisq/cli/CliMain.java

Lines changed: 0 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-468,17 +468,6 @@ public static void run(String[] args) {
468468
new TableBuilder(OFFER_TBL, offer).build().print(out);
469469
return;
470470
}
471-
case getmyoffer: {
472-
var opts = new OfferIdOptionParser(args).parse();
473-
if (opts.isForHelp()) {
474-
out.println(client.getMethodHelp(method));
475-
return;
476-
}
477-
var offerId = opts.getOfferId();
478-
var offer = client.getMyOffer(offerId);
479-
new TableBuilder(OFFER_TBL, offer).build().print(out);
480-
return;
481-
}
482471
case getoffers: {
483472
var opts = new GetOffersOptionParser(args).parse();
484473
if (opts.isForHelp()) {
@@ -941,8 +930,6 @@ private static void printHelp(OptionParser parser, @SuppressWarnings("SameParame
941930
stream.println();
942931
stream.format(rowFormat, getoffer.name(), "--offer-id=<offer-id>", "Get current offer with id");
943932
stream.println();
944-
stream.format(rowFormat, getmyoffer.name(), "--offer-id=<offer-id>", "Get my current offer with id");
945-
stream.println();
946933
stream.format(rowFormat, getoffers.name(), "--direction=<buy|sell> \\", "Get current offers");
947934
stream.format(rowFormat, "", "--currency-code=<currency-code>", "");
948935
stream.println();

cli/src/main/java/bisq/cli/GrpcClient.java

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-291,12 +291,6 @@ public OfferInfo getOffer(String offerId) {
291291
return offersServiceRequest.getOffer(offerId);
292292
}
293293

294-
@Deprecated // Since 5-Dec-2021.
295-
// Endpoint to be removed from future version. Use getOffer service method instead.
296-
public OfferInfo getMyOffer(String offerId) {
297-
return offersServiceRequest.getMyOffer(offerId);
298-
}
299-
300294
public List<OfferInfo> getBsqSwapOffers(String direction) {
301295
return offersServiceRequest.getBsqSwapOffers(direction);
302296
}

cli/src/main/java/bisq/cli/Method.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-34,8 +34,6 @@ public enum Method {
3434
getbalance,
3535
getbtcprice,
3636
getfundingaddresses,
37-
@Deprecated // Since 27-Dec-2021.
38-
getmyoffer, // Endpoint to be removed from future version. Use getoffer instead.
3937
getmyoffers,
4038
getnetwork,
4139
getoffer,

cli/src/main/java/bisq/cli/request/OffersServiceRequest.java

Lines changed: 4 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-22,7 +22,6 @@
2222
import bisq.proto.grpc.CreateOfferRequest;
2323
import bisq.proto.grpc.EditOfferRequest;
2424
import bisq.proto.grpc.GetBsqSwapOffersRequest;
25-
import bisq.proto.grpc.GetMyOfferRequest;
2625
import bisq.proto.grpc.GetMyOffersRequest;
2726
import bisq.proto.grpc.GetOfferCategoryRequest;
2827
import bisq.proto.grpc.GetOfferRequest;
@@ -125,7 +124,7 @@ public OfferInfo createOffer(String direction,
125124
}
126125

127126
public void editOfferActivationState(String offerId, int enable) {
128-
var offer = getMyOffer(offerId);
127+
var offer = getOffer(offerId);
129128
var offerPrice = offer.getUseMarketBasedPrice()
130129
? "0.00"
131130
: offer.getPrice();
@@ -139,7 +138,7 @@ public void editOfferActivationState(String offerId, int enable) {
139138
}
140139

141140
public void editOfferFixedPrice(String offerId, String rawPriceString) {
142-
var offer = getMyOffer(offerId);
141+
var offer = getOffer(offerId);
143142
editOffer(offerId,
144143
rawPriceString,
145144
false,
@@ -150,7 +149,7 @@ public void editOfferFixedPrice(String offerId, String rawPriceString) {
150149
}
151150

152151
public void editOfferPriceMargin(String offerId, double marketPriceMarginPct) {
153-
var offer = getMyOffer(offerId);
152+
var offer = getOffer(offerId);
154153
editOffer(offerId,
155154
"0.00",
156155
true,
@@ -161,7 +160,7 @@ public void editOfferPriceMargin(String offerId, double marketPriceMarginPct) {
161160
}
162161

163162
public void editOfferTriggerPrice(String offerId, String triggerPrice) {
164-
var offer = getMyOffer(offerId);
163+
var offer = getOffer(offerId);
165164
editOffer(offerId,
166165
"0.00",
167166
offer.getUseMarketBasedPrice(),
@@ -216,13 +215,6 @@ public OfferInfo getOffer(String offerId) {
216215
return grpcStubs.offersService.getOffer(request).getOffer();
217216
}
218217

219-
public OfferInfo getMyOffer(String offerId) {
220-
var request = GetMyOfferRequest.newBuilder()
221-
.setId(offerId)
222-
.build();
223-
return grpcStubs.offersService.getMyOffer(request).getOffer();
224-
}
225-
226218
public List<OfferInfo> getBsqSwapOffers(String direction) {
227219
var request = GetBsqSwapOffersRequest.newBuilder()
228220
.setDirection(direction)

core/src/main/java/bisq/core/api/CoreApi.java

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-150,10 +150,6 @@ public Optional<Offer> findAvailableOffer(String id) {
150150
return coreOffersService.findAvailableOffer(id);
151151
}
152152

153-
public OpenOffer getMyOffer(String id) {
154-
return coreOffersService.getMyOffer(id);
155-
}
156-
157153
public Optional<OpenOffer> findMyOpenOffer(String id) {
158154
return coreOffersService.findMyOpenOffer(id);
159155
}

core/src/main/resources/help/getmyoffer-help.txt

Lines changed: 0 additions & 25 deletions
This file was deleted.

daemon/src/main/java/bisq/daemon/grpc/GrpcOffersService.java

Lines changed: 0 additions & 20 deletions
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,6 @@
3535
import bisq.proto.grpc.GetBsqSwapOffersRequest;
3636
import bisq.proto.grpc.GetMyBsqSwapOfferReply;
3737
import bisq.proto.grpc.GetMyBsqSwapOffersReply;
38-
import bisq.proto.grpc.GetMyOfferReply;
3938
import bisq.proto.grpc.GetMyOfferRequest;
4039
import bisq.proto.grpc.GetMyOffersReply;
4140
import bisq.proto.grpc.GetMyOffersRequest;
@@ -58,7 +57,6 @@
5857

5958
import lombok.extern.slf4j.Slf4j;
6059

61-
import static bisq.core.api.model.OfferInfo.toMyOfferInfo;
6260
import static bisq.core.api.model.OfferInfo.toMyPendingOfferInfo;
6361
import static bisq.core.api.model.OfferInfo.toOfferInfo;
6462
import static bisq.daemon.grpc.interceptor.GrpcServiceRateMeteringConfig.getCustomRateMeteringInterceptor;
@@ -154,23 +152,6 @@ public void getMyBsqSwapOffer(GetMyOfferRequest req,
154152
}
155153
}
156154

157-
@Deprecated // Since 27-Dec-2021.
158-
// Endpoint to be removed from future version. Use getOffer service method instead.
159-
@Override
160-
public void getMyOffer(GetMyOfferRequest req,
161-
StreamObserver<GetMyOfferReply> responseObserver) {
162-
try {
163-
OpenOffer openOffer = coreApi.getMyOffer(req.getId());
164-
var reply = GetMyOfferReply.newBuilder()
165-
.setOffer(toMyOfferInfo(openOffer).toProtoMessage())
166-
.build();
167-
responseObserver.onNext(reply);
168-
responseObserver.onCompleted();
169-
} catch (Throwable cause) {
170-
exceptionHandler.handleException(log, cause, responseObserver);
171-
}
172-
}
173-
174155
@Override
175156
public void getBsqSwapOffers(GetBsqSwapOffersRequest req,
176157
StreamObserver<GetBsqSwapOffersReply> responseObserver) {
@@ -349,7 +330,6 @@ final Optional<ServerInterceptor> rateMeteringInterceptor() {
349330
new HashMap<>() {{
350331
put(getGetOfferCategoryMethod().getFullMethodName(), new GrpcCallRateMeter(1, SECONDS));
351332
put(getGetOfferMethod().getFullMethodName(), new GrpcCallRateMeter(1, SECONDS));
352-
put(getGetMyOfferMethod().getFullMethodName(), new GrpcCallRateMeter(1, SECONDS));
353333
put(getGetOffersMethod().getFullMethodName(), new GrpcCallRateMeter(1, SECONDS));
354334
put(getGetMyOffersMethod().getFullMethodName(), new GrpcCallRateMeter(1, SECONDS));
355335
put(getCreateOfferMethod().getFullMethodName(), new GrpcCallRateMeter(1, MINUTES));

proto/src/main/proto/grpc.proto

Lines changed: 0 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-73,9 +73,6 @@ service Offers {
7373
// Get user's BSQ swap offer with offer-id.
7474
rpc GetMyBsqSwapOffer (GetMyOfferRequest) returns (GetMyBsqSwapOfferReply) {
7575
}
76-
// Get my open v1 protocol offer with offer-id. Deprecated since 27-Dec-2021 (v1.8.0). Use GetOffer.
77-
rpc GetMyOffer (GetMyOfferRequest) returns (GetMyOfferReply) {
78-
}
7976
// Get all available BSQ swap offers with a BUY (BTC) or SELL (BTC) direction.
8077
rpc GetBsqSwapOffers (GetBsqSwapOffersRequest) returns (GetBsqSwapOffersReply) {
8178
}
@@ -140,11 +137,6 @@ message GetMyOfferRequest {
140137
string id = 1; // The offer's unique identifier.
141138
}
142139

143-
// Deprecated with rpc method GetMyOffer since 27-Dec-2021 (v1.8.0).
144-
message GetMyOfferReply {
145-
OfferInfo offer = 1; // The returned v1 protocol offer.
146-
}
147-
148140
message GetOffersRequest {
149141
string direction = 1; // The offer's BUY (BTC) or SELL (BTC) direction.
150142
string currency_code = 2; // The offer's fiat or altcoin currency code.

0 commit comments

Comments
 (0)